This heavy rope, used by shrimp fishermen, was photographed in Apalachicola, Florida. Working shrimp boats can be seen there at the central waterfront park on Market Street; the public marina; and the Apalachicola River and Gulf of Mexico.
The variety of colors and wonderful textures are eye-catching in this natural abstract.
Apalachicola is located on the Gulf coast on the Florida panhandle. In past times, it was the third busiest port in the south. Today, it is a quaint little town with great seafood restaurants serving local fare. Shrimp and oysters are particularly popular.
The whole town has a nautical, maritime flavor. This close up image of one of the tools of the trade captures the essence of that character.
